Definition
  1. Adjective:

    • Relating to the human spirit or soul, as opposed to physical or material things: "Spiritual" describes matters concerning the inner, non-physical essence of a person, such as their values, beliefs, and sense of purpose.
    • Relating to sacred or religious matters: "Spiritual" can describe things connected to religion, faith, or the divine.
    • Resembling or characteristic of a spirit; lacking a physical form: "Spiritual" can describe something that seems ghostly, ethereal, or not of the material world.
  2. Noun:

    • A religious folk song, especially one originating among African Americans in the southern United States: A "spiritual" is a type of song with themes from Christian beliefs, often created and sung within a community.
Examples of Usage
  • Adjective:

    • She found spiritual comfort in meditation. (Here, "spiritual" relates to inner peace and well-being.)
    • The priest is a spiritual leader for the community. (Here, "spiritual" relates to religious guidance.)
    • The medium claimed to have a spiritual connection with the other side. (Here, "spiritual" relates to the non-physical realm of spirits.)
  • Noun:

    • The choir sang a powerful spiritual called "Swing Low, Sweet Chariot." (Here, "spiritual" is a specific type of religious song.)
Advanced Usage
  • "Spiritual awakening": A profound realization or shift in one's inner life or religious understanding.
    • His journey led to a deep spiritual awakening.
  • "Spiritual but not religious": A phrase used to describe a person who believes in or seeks a connection with a higher power or inner truth but does not follow a specific organized religion.
    • Many people today identify as spiritual but not religious.
Variants and Related Words
  • Spirituality (n): The quality of being concerned with the human spirit or soul.
    • She explores themes of spirituality in her poetry.
  • Spiritually (adv): In a way that relates to the spirit.
    • He felt spiritually renewed after the retreat.
Synonyms
  • Adjective: Non-material, inner, religious, sacred, ecclesiastical, ethereal, incorporeal.
  • Noun: Hymn, gospel song, religious song.
Related Phrases
  • Spiritual guidance: Advice or leadership in matters of faith or personal growth.
    • She sought spiritual guidance from her mentor.
  • Spiritual home: A place where one feels a deep sense of belonging or connection, often related to beliefs.
    • The ancient temple felt like his spiritual home.
